2019 Women Who Build: Kristin Irwin, Patriquin Architects

February 15, 2019 - Connecticut

Name: Kristin Irwin

Position: Design Associate

Company: Patriquin Architects

How many years have you been in your current field? 11 years

What was your first job and what did you learn from it? My first architectural job was as an intern for a small firm during college. I realized quickly that architecture was not always the glamorous career that I had imagined. Of course, I had the opportunity to work on some really fantastic projects, but more often than not I was working on smaller jobs such as bathroom additions. 

I remember one job was to remodel an existing house that was abandoned for at least 10 years. Measuring this building must have been physically the worst place I have ever been in. What stood out to me was meeting our clients and seeing their excitement as we presented the design of their future home. 

The lesson I learned was that no matter what the job is, it will always be important to your client, so you should take pride in it.
